THE PERFECT FIT

Handlebar Adjustments

Follow these steps to adjust the handlebars for a personal fit.
1. Remove the handlebar cover to

expose the handlebar and the four

adjuster block bolts (A).

2. Using a 7/16″ (11 mm) wrench,

loosen the four nuts on the bottom

of the adjuster block (turn handlebar

to left or right for access to back

nuts).

NOTE: It may be necessary to pry the

adjuster blocks apart with a screw driver.
3. Adjust the handlebar to the desired height. Be sure handlebars,

brake lever and throttle lever operate smoothly and do not hit the

gas tank, windshield or any other part of the machine when turned

fully to the left or right.

4. Torque the handlebar adjuster block bolts to 11-13 ft. lbs. (15-18

Nm).

5. Replace the handlebar cover.

Improper adjustment of the handlebars or incorrect torquing of

the adjuster block tightening bolts can cause limited steering or

loosening of the handlebars, resulting in loss of control and

possible serious personal injury or death. Follow the adjustment

procedures exactly, or see your Polaris dealer for service.
